Mail an Alias unzustellbar, weil lmtp das Postfach nicht findet?
D.K.
mlists.postfix.users at pro-ite.com
Sa Jun 4 15:34:54 CEST 2016
Hallo,
ich hab hier ein debian8 mit postfix, dovecot, mysql.
Mail senden an Userpostfach funktioniert.
Senden an Alias wird zurückgewiesen.
Meines Erachtens erkennt postfix/smtpd die Zuordnung user2-alias at xxx.de
zu user2 at xxx.de völlig korrekt. (siehe unten)
Im lmtp wird dann aber der recipient wieder mit der alias-Adresse belegt
und dann ist die Zustellung nicht mehr möglich:
<User2-alias at xxx.de>: host xxx.de[private/dovecot-lmtp]
said: 550 5.1.1 <User2-alias at xxx.de> User doesn't exist:
User2-alias at xxx.de (in reply to RCPT TO command)
Nach drei "-v" (smtp/smtpd, lmtp, dovecot/pipe) in der master.cf bin ich
auf folgende Ausschnitte gekommen:
...
Jun 4 13:06:08 d8x1 postfix/smtpd[16835]: < localhost[127.0.0.1]: RCPT
TO:<user2-alias at xxx.de>
...
Jun 4 13:06:08 d8x1 postfix/smtpd[16835]: maps_find:
virtual_alias_maps: mysql:/etc/postfix/mysql_alias.cf(0,lock|fold_fix):
user2-alias at xxx.de = user2 at xxx.de
Jun 4 13:06:08 d8x1 postfix/smtpd[16835]: mail_addr_find:
user2-alias at xxx.de -> user2 at xxx.de
...
Jun 4 13:06:08 d8x1 postfix/lmtp[16840]: lmtp socket: wanted attribute:
original_recipient
Jun 4 13:06:08 d8x1 postfix/lmtp[16840]: input attribute name:
original_recipient
Jun 4 13:06:08 d8x1 postfix/lmtp[16840]: input attribute value:
user2-alias at xxx.de
Jun 4 13:06:08 d8x1 postfix/lmtp[16840]: lmtp socket: wanted attribute:
recipient
Jun 4 13:06:08 d8x1 postfix/lmtp[16840]: input attribute name: recipient
Jun 4 13:06:08 d8x1 postfix/lmtp[16840]: input attribute value:
user2-alias at xxx.de
Und damit geht das schief. Jemand ne Idee, wo wir da noch ansetzen können?
Wer ist an der Stelle zuständig, den "input attribute name: recipient"
mit dem korrekten Wert zu setzen?
Ist es sinnvoll, hier die ganze postconf (864 Zeilen) oder die postconf
-n (63 Zeilen) zu posten?
Danke, Dirk
Mehr Informationen über die Mailingliste Postfixbuch-users